Exploring Your SIM Card: Unraveling Mobile Connectivity

Your SIM card is the core component that allows your mobile device to access cellular networks. It contains crucial information about your account, including your IMEI number, network provider, and other settings.

Understanding this information can empower you in various ways, such as managing your mobile plan.


You can access SIM info through different approaches, depending on your device's operating system.

For instance, on Android devices, you can usually find SIM information in the device settings. On iOS devices, you may need to access the network settings section.

Remember that accessing and sharing SIM information should be done with prudence more info as it contains sensitive personal data.

The Pakistani SIM Info System: Transparency and Security

Pakistan has recently implemented a novel system for managing SIM records. This initiative aims to boost transparency within the telecom sector while also strengthening security measures against fraudulent activities. The system allows users to access their individual SIM information, including details about ownership, registration, and usage. This openness empowers individuals to control their SIM data, fostering trust and accountability.

  • The system is also designed to address SIM-based fraud by applying stricter identification protocols.
  • Moreover, it facilitates law agencies ' ability to locate fraudulent SIM usage, helping in maintaining national security.

Despite this, there are concerns regarding the possibility of data breaches and misuse through the system. It is important that the government ensures robust cybersecurity measures to protect user privacy.
